Understanding when commercial deck or porch replacement is necessary often begins with recognizing signs of deterioration or damage that compromise safety and functionality. Over time, exposure to weather elements like rain, snow, and sun can cause decks and porches to weaken, warp, or rot, especially if they weren't built with durable materials or have experienced wear and tear. Homeowners or property managers searching for this topic are typically concerned about structural integrity, safety hazards, or the need to update the appearance of their outdoor spaces. Whether for a retail storefront, apartment complex, or office building, identifying these issues early can prevent accidents and extend the lifespan of the property’s exterior features.

This topic also relates closely to planning for property upgrades or maintenance projects. Commercial decks and porches often serve as important entry points or outdoor gathering areas, making their condition a priority for maintaining curb appeal and customer or tenant satisfaction. Problems that signal the need for replacement include loose or unstable decking boards, significant wood rot, rusted or damaged support structures, or surfaces that have become uneven or splintered. When is a complete replacement of a commercial deck or porch necessary? A full replacement may be needed when the structure shows extensive damage, such as rotting, severe warping, or widespread deterioration that cannot be repaired effectively.

How do I know if my commercial deck or porch has structural issues? Signs like sagging, loose or cracked boards, and instability indicate potential structural problems that local contractors can assess to determine if replacement is required.

What are common signs of water damage on a commercial porch or deck? Visible water stains, mold, mildew, or soft, spongy areas suggest water infiltration that can weaken the structure and may necessitate replacement services.

When should a commercial deck or porch be replaced due to safety concerns? Replacement is advisable when structural components are compromised, creating hazards such as falling risks or collapse potential that cannot be remedied through repairs.

Can minor damages on a commercial porch or deck be repaired instead of replaced? Minor issues like small cracks or surface wear can often be repaired, but extensive damage or ongoing problems typically require a full replacement handled by local service providers.
